Riverdale Cemetery v. St. Mary's Roman Catholic CH

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of New York, Fourth Department
Jan 15, 1941
261 App. Div. 883 (N.Y. App. Div. 1941)

Opinion

January 15, 1941.

Present — Crosby, P.J., Cunningham, Taylor, Harris and McCurn, JJ.


Motion to amend order entered November 8, 1940 [ 260 App. Div. 984], denied. Motion for leave to appeal to the Court of Appeals denied. Memorandum: Our decision in this case was not based upon section 7-a Relig. Corp. of the Religious Corporations Law. The complaint, including the contract which is made a part thereof, does not successfully plead possession in the plaintiffs-appellants. It shows on the other hand that defendants-respondents have been in continuous possession since 1897. The Statute of Limitations is, therefore, a bar. A complaint that states facts constituting a defense against the cause of action therein set forth does not state a cause of action. ( Beisheim v. People, 255 App. Div. 429.)
